Since beta testing, prior to Live 4 release, Live 4 has had a serious issue with VSTi initialization. I've pointed this out numerous times and never seem to get a response. Forum or Email. I've done extensive testing on this topic.
Scenerio #1:
1. Load a song with a VSTi instrument (something like Atmosphere)
2. Don't hit any MIDI keys yet
3. Start the song
4. Mid-song, start playing the VST instrument via external MIDI keyboard
5. Live pauses for a second for the VST to initialize... very bad!!!!
I think I might have figured out part of what's going on. VSTi's from the previous song might not have been released. Check this out...
Scenerio #2:
1. Load a song that contains SampleTank FREE (it only allows ONE instance of it to be loaded)
2. Don't hit any MIDI keys yet
3. Start the song
4. Mid-song, start playing the VST instrument via external MIDI keyboard
5. Live pauses for a second for the VST to initialize... very bad!!!!
6. Load a different song that also contains SampleTank FREE
7. Attempt to play a sound on SampleTank FREE... NOTHING!!!
8. Attempt to open the edit window for SampleTank FREE
9. It claims that you cannot open more than one instance of it
10. Obviously, when loading a song, the VSTi from previous song are not unloaded.
I seriously hope this get's fixed in one of the upcoming fixes. Definitly affects LIVE performances. Which is what LIVE was built for.

I can confirm the second bug relating to the unloading of vsti's when changing sets.
In my case, Sonik Synth 2 Free version which only allows for one instance as well..
If you open a set with SS2 in it, then open a second set with SS2 in it, the result is a non-functioning SS2 because it thinks you are trying to load two instances (which logically means it thinks it is opening while the other instance in the first set hasn't been closed yet.)

We are investiagating this issue, but we found that this problem is related to operating system and memory management issues in the plug-ins. You will find this problems in every host available.
Don't get me wrong. We know this is a big issue and will spend time to find solutions. But we only have this 100% under our control for our own built-in devices.
